Some facts:

  • We’re licensed to educate and care for 15,000 full-time children daily.
  • 18,000 families use BestStart services annually.
  • We have over 270 centres nationwide located from Whangarei to Invercargill.
  • Each centre is managed by a Centre Manager who is supported by a local Area Manager. This gives our centre teams ongoing quality training and support.
  • Te Whāriki, the world-wide acclaimed national early childhood education curriculum, is used in all centres.
  • We have over 4500 permanent teachers nationally. Over 90% of our permanent teaching staff are either fully qualified with a diploma or bachelor of teaching (ECE) or higher, or are in training. These figures are very high by national standards within the ECE sector.
  • We provide a two-year Advice and Guidance Programme for all recently certified teachers, providing further mentoring and training. This gives strong support for teachers from provisional registration to full teacher registration with the NZ Teachers Council.
  • We regularly spend around $4 million on teacher training per annum.

Rainbow Cottage Kindergarten

Welcome to our kindergarten!

Rainbow Cottage is a private kindergarten which is family owned and operated. We are licensed for 25 children over the age of 2 for sessional and all-day care. We are a small and personal centre, with a tight-knit professional team of teachers who work hard to provide a fun, educational and nurturing environment. We are particularly proud of our outdoor setting with its large playground and wide range of equipment. We enjoy providing exciting musical experiences. We also love to get to know our families and have them feel a part of our kindergarten community.

Programme

We run a semi-structured programme based on the early childhood curriculum ‘Te Whaariki’. Planning and activities are centred on a weekly theme that has been developed by observing emergent interests. We provide for a balance of creative self-expression, skill development and group activities. Art, music, drama and stories are incorporated into the weekly focus. The children are all encouraged to complete at least one piece of work to take home each day, fostering a sense of achievement. We have a routine throughout our sessions which provides a sense of security. We have an extension programme for the older children before they begin school (our ‘Before Programme’).

Horizons Montessori Preschool

Horizons Montessori Preschool opened in 2000 and is proudly owned and operated by Mike and Helen Emberson, both qualified early childhood teachers.

Since 2013 our ERO report has assessed us as very well placed to promote positive learning outcomes for children.  We are proud that this assessment positions us in the top 20% of New Zealand preschool centres and requires a routine visit every four years.

Our preschool offers a family feel, catering to 30 children aged 2-6 years, with a caring and nurturing atmosphere.  It’s a place that teachers’ parents and children can feel a strong sense of ownership and belonging – a wonderful foundation for the early years.

We are inspired by children’s interest and love of learning and we support this through an environment rich in resources and devoted, passionate Early Childhood teachers.

Montessori Philosophy

We view children as competent and confident learners.  Our centre philosophy strives to enhance learning opportunities through the philosophy and equipment of Maria Montessori and Te Whāriki the national early childhood curriculum.

We are a distinctive service as we offer a balance of both structured and freeplay periods throughout the day, where learning is a fun and exciting journey of discovery.  Children and teachers co-construct knowledge alongside the active partnership we develop with parents.

We capture and document children’s learning through in-depth assessment documentation.  Teachers use a checklist to track children’s academic knowledge (colours, numbers, shapes, letters, sight words, and scissor skills).  This helps us to understand the child’s current knowledge and to tailor a programme that supports their progress.  Learning stories are used to notice, recognize and respond to children’s emergent interests and supports our planning process.  

The children’s e-portfolios are produced through Educa.  Educa is an ideal way for parents, children and teachers to share and be involved in their child’s learning experiences.  Educa allows parents to invite other family members or friends to engage in their child’s portfolio, to add stories and comments and be involved.  Educa operates a secure site allowing only those invited to access children’s portfolios using a password of their preference. The ease of use of Educa means that stories are accessible immediately and can be viewed on any mobile device such as phone, ipad or computer.  You will receive an alert to let you know something has been added.

Our teacher/child ratio of 1:5 is integral to offering the children scaffolded learning through sustained interest areas such as research and enquiry.  It also provides us the time and opportunity to actively play and participate as we establish strong relationships based on mutual respect and trust. Children freely choose their own activities with teachers encouragement and support to try new challenges, learn new skills and develop their individual interests.

It is important that teachers, families and children feel a strong sense of cultural connection within the preschool where all cultures are respected and celebrated. Biculturalism is supported through understanding Maori culture, language and identity through developing our partnership with whanau and iwi.
